Fig. 3From: Significant differences in terms of codon usage bias between bacteriophage early and late genes: a comparative genomics analysisComparative analysis of early and late genes in 14 different bacteriophages. Details can be found in the main text. a A phylogenetic tree built from complete phage proteomes using ARS distance (see Materials and Methods). Phages with significant differences in temporary codon usage are marked by blue. b Viruses with significant (p-value <0.05) separation between early and late genes w.r.t synonymous codons or AA are marked by yellow stars. c Significance of separation between early and late genes w.r.t additional genomic features estimated by Wilcoxon ranksum p-value. Features/viruses with significant (p-value <0.05) separation between the two temporal groups are marked by yellow stars; green is related to higher mean in the case of the early genes and red is related to higher mean in the case of the late genesBack to article page
